Basement Sump Pump Service in Framingham, MA
Basement sump pump services involve the installation, repair, and maintenance of sump pumps designed to protect homes from flooding and excess moisture. These systems are typically installed in the lowest part of a basement or crawl space to automatically remove water that accumulates due to heavy rain, melting snow, or groundwater seepage. Homeowners often request sump pump services when experiencing frequent basement flooding, noticing water pooling in their foundation, or preparing for seasonal weather conditions that increase the risk of water intrusion. Understanding the type of sump pump suitable for the property, as well as the system’s maintenance needs, can help ensure reliable operation and protect the home’s foundation.
Before requesting sump pump services, property owners usually want to know about the different system options available, such as pedestal or submersible pumps, and how each functions in relation to their specific basement conditions. It’s also helpful to understand the importance of regular inspections, potential upgrades for increased capacity, and the proper placement of the sump pit to optimize performance. Clarifying these details can assist homeowners in making informed decisions to safeguard their property against water damage and maintain a dry, stable basement environment.

Basement Sump Pump Service Questions
What is a sump pump used for in a basement? It helps remove excess water that accumulates in the basement to prevent flooding and water damage.
How often should a sump pump be inspected? Regular inspections are recommended to ensure proper operation, especially before heavy rain seasons.
What are common signs a sump pump needs repair? Frequent cycling, strange noises, or failure to turn on are typical indicators of issues.
Can a sump pump be upgraded or replaced easily? Yes, replacing or upgrading with newer models can improve performance and reliability.
